In this review of the MUMTOP Indoor Outdoor Thermometer the bottom line is simple: this is a no-nonsense, low-maintenance temperature gauge for anyone who needs a clear, durable readout outdoors or in light indoor spaces. The reviewer found it especially useful for patios, greenhouses and garden sheds because its waterproof plastic case and acrylic dial stand up to wet weather without rusting, while the large numbers are easy to read from a distance. It is entirely mechanical, requires no battery, and settles to an accurate reading by itself over a few hours.
Key Features
- Weatherproof construction: A waterproof plastic case and acrylic dial protect the unit so it resists rust and handles four seasons outdoors.
- Wide temperature range: The dial covers -40 to 60 C (-40 to 140 F), making it suitable from freezing winter conditions to hot summer days.
- Dual scale display: Both Celsius and Fahrenheit are printed on the face so you can read the scale you prefer without conversion.
- Large, legible numbers: The light colored background and oversized numerals make it easy to read the temperature from across a patio or yard.
- Battery-free operation: The built-in temperature gauge requires no power and automatically senses ambient temperature within a few hours.
- Simple mounting: A back hook design lets the thermometer hang on a nail or screw for quick installation in many locations.
Who It's For
This thermometer fits homeowners who want a trouble-free display for outdoor living areas, gardeners monitoring greenhouse conditions, and anyone who prefers a mechanical gauge over electronic devices. Its robust plastic housing and acrylic face make it a sensible choice for patios, garden walls, sheds, and wine cabinets where moisture or humidity can be an issue.
It is less suitable for users needing advanced features such as remote sensors, wireless connectivity, or data logging. If you require minute-by-minute indoor climate tracking or integrated smart-home reporting, a digital weather station would be a better match.

Specifications
| Brand | MUMTOP |
| Case material | Waterproof plastic |
| Dial material | Acrylic |
| Temperature range | -40 to 60 C (-40 to 140 F) |
| Display | Celsius and Fahrenheit scales |
| Power | No battery, built-in gauge |
| Mounting | Back hook for hanging |
